Common Skills to Support Leadership
There are a lot of skills you must improve in order to sharpen your leadership skill. Some of the essential skills that support leadership skills are:
- Establishing trust and credibility: Leadership can be difficult if team members do not trust the leader or believe in his/her decisions. Thus, it is important for leaders to develop a sense of respect and trust in the group by being honest, reliable, and consistent.
- Communicating effectively: Leaders must be able to communicate their ideas and goals clearly so that their team can understand them and act accordingly. Furthermore, they need to be able to listen to feedback from their team members in order to make informed decisions.
- Delegating tasks: As a leader, it is important to delegate tasks appropriately so that everyone has something to do and feels valued for their contribution. This requires careful consideration of each individual’s strengths and weaknesses in order to maximize effectiveness.
- Inspiring others: Leaders must possess the ability to inspire their team in order for them to commit themselves fully to a task or project. They should use positive reinforcement, motivation, and recognition as tools in order to foster an environment of enthusiasm and commitment among their staff.
- Managing conflict: Conflict is inevitable in any work environment, but good leaders know how to manage it effectively without creating further problems. They should be able to identify the root cause of the conflict and take steps to resolve it in a timely manner.
These are just some of the most important skills which can be developed and improved in order to become an effective leader. It is important for leaders to continually try to hone these skills in order to stay ahead of the curve and lead their teams effectively.

How to Overcome The Challenges In Leadership
It is difficult to be a leader. There are a lot of challenges you need to overcome. Here are some tips to overcome the challenges in leadership:
- Staying focused on the organization’s mission: It is important for leaders to stay true to their company’s mission and values. Without a clear direction, it can be difficult to keep employees motivated and aligned with the organization’s goals.
- Building trust: Trust between leaders and their team members is essential for successful collaboration and productivity. Leaders must be able to build trust by demonstrating honesty, integrity, fairness, and reliability.
- Dealing with conflict: Conflict within any organizational structure is unavoidable. Leaders must be able to effectively manage disagreements in order to maintain positive working relationships within the team or department.
- Adapting to change: The business world is constantly changing due to technological advances, consumer trends, economic shifts, etc., making it necessary for leaders to be able to adapt quickly and strategically if they want their organizations to remain competitive in the marketplace.
- Making tough decisions: Leadership involves making difficult decisions at times that may involve risk-taking or unpopular choices among colleagues or stakeholders. This can be challenging as there is no one-size-fits-all solution when it comes to decision-making as a leader of an organization
